## Idempotency Keys for Payment Retries (Lumopay)

Every retry of a charge request must reuse the original idempotency key; generating a new key on retry can produce duplicate charges. Keys are scoped per merchant and expire after 48 hours. Reviewers should verify keys are derived server-side, never from client input. The full key-generation specification and threat model are maintained on the internal page.

dashboard of kaguf-tawip = https://vault.merlaqsys.test/issue

Management Meeting Minutes — Franchise Agreement

Quick summary for the incoming director: we spent most of the hour on the proposed Bramleigh Kitchens franchise terms. The royalty rate is settled, but territory exclusivity is still sticky. Legal wants tighter renewal clauses; operations wants faster rollout. We agreed to counter next week. The thinking behind our position is captured below.

board note of fahif-yahog: Gross margin on Wenath came in at 10 percent against a plan of 5 percent. Only 3 of the 100 pilot accounts renewed Wenath, so a churn review is set for July 15.

`tailcat` is the internal CLI for tailing service logs at Mirewood. Binaries are built only by the Foundry pipeline; local builds are never distributed. Each release embeds the source revision, builder identity, and dependency lockfile hash. Verify any binary with `tailcat --provenance` before trusting it on a prod host.

Releases are signed by the pipeline key and mirrored to the artifact cache. Do not hand-edit release metadata. The provenance record for the current stable binary begins with the token shown below.

pipeline stamp: htk9_ce63042d9